Meanings and Origins of the name Archie And Reggie

The name Archie is often regarded as a diminutive form of the name Archibald, which has Germanic roots meaning “genuine” and "bold." Despite its vintage origins, Archie has gained fresh popularity and stood independently as a given name.

On the flip side, Reggie typically stems from the name Reginald, which is derived from the Latin name Reginaldus and means "ruler's advisor." Like Archie, Reggie possesses historical significance that has seamlessly transitioned into modern vernacular.

Popularity of the name Archie And Reggie

Archie and Reggie enjoy robust popularity in various parts of the world, particularly in English-speaking countries. Archie saw a significant boost after the birth of Archie Harrison Mountbatten-Windsor, the son of Prince Harry and Meghan Markle. This royal connection instantly propelled Archie to newfound fame, allowing it to soar on the popularity charts in the United Kingdom and beyond.

Reggie, meanwhile, maintains its charm with consistent, steady popularity. Often associated with personalities from the world of sports and arts, Reggie remains a popular staple, particularly in communities that admire strong, straightforward names.

In the US, Archie once had a steady hold in the mid-20th century and has seen a resurgence in recent years. Reggie's natural flexibility and energetic vibe have secured its place on many expectant parents' lists, appealing to those looking for a name both sturdy and playful.
